Hiking in St. John

The Best Hiking Itinerary for St. John

US Virgin Islands & BVI

Two-thirds of St. John is protected national parkland, making it one of the most spectacular hiking destinations in the Caribbean. From coastal trails with panoramic ocean views to deep valley descents past 800-year-old petroglyphs, every trail on this island rewards you with something you will never forget.

Your 3-Day Sample Itinerary

1

Lind Point Trail to Honeymoon Beach

Start with the Lind Point Trail from the Cruz Bay visitor center. It is a moderate hike through tropical forest that ends at Honeymoon Beach — one of St. John's most beautiful stretches of sand, and the perfect reward after a morning of hiking.

2

Reef Bay Trail & Ancient Petroglyphs

The Reef Bay Trail is St. John's signature hike — a 2.5-mile descent through sugar plantation ruins and tropical forest to a waterfall pool with pre-Columbian petroglyphs carved into the rocks. Take the NPS ranger-led tour for the full story.

3

Ram Head Trail Sunrise

Wake before dawn and hike the Ram Head Trail on the island's southeastern tip. The trail crosses cactus-dotted terrain before reaching a dramatic cliff overlooking the Caribbean Sea — the most breathtaking sunrise viewpoint in the USVI.
